Uniform Evidence Law: Principles and Practice was previously published by CCH Australia.This second edition of Uniform Evidence Law: Principles and Practice is an invaluable reference for students of evidence law and litigation practitioners. It provides a succinct, clear and comprehensive statement and analysis of the Uniform Evidence Law as at November 2014.The book provides an overarching and detailed analysis of the law of evidence applicable in those jurisdictions that have adopted the model Uniform Evidence Law: the Commonwealth, New South Wales, Tasmania, Victoria, Australian Capital Territory and now, since 2012, the Northern Territory.Students will gain invaluable insight from the authors who analyse the Uniform Evidence Law by reference to its history, its underlying policy and its operation in practice. Explanations and evaluations of the principles on which the law is based, identification of its often-conflicting rationales, and suggestions for how it might be made more principled and coherent will prove extremely helpful for students.New to this editionThis second edition reflects significant updates, given the continued evolution of the Uniform Evidence Act. Changes to the Act reflected in this edition include:its introduction in the Northern Territorythe modification of the right to silence in the New South Wales Actthe addition of a journalists' privilege in New South Wales and Victoria, andthe emergence of some further differences in the interpretation and application of tendency and coincidence evidence between the states.

UNIFORM EVIDENCE LAW 9th Edition is the leading Australian guide to uniform evidence legislation, widely used by practitioners and students alike. This highly anticipated 9th Edition contains commentary on the uniform evidence legislation and case law for the Commonwealth, NSW and Victoria, current to 1 June 2010. Stephen Odgers SC once again provides his incisive analysis and insights into the latest developments, drawing on his extensive Bar experience and his background in both law reform and academia. In addition to all new law, the 9th Edition commentary now contains an expanded introduction, and extensive reference to NSW and Victorian Bench books for guidance on judicial directions to juries. Furthermore, the 9th Edition contains fresh extracts from a range of relevant legislation including relevant extracts from criminal procedure legislation from NSW and Victoria. Over a quarter of the evidence legislation's provisions are subjected to significant judicial interpretation each year, making it essential to have a current copy of the annotated Act at hand, to stay abreast of developments. With its highly accessible, annotated legislation format as well as comprehensive commentary on the ALRC foundations of the law, UNIFORM EVIDENCE LAW 9th Edition continues to be the authoritative resource on the NSW, Commonwealth and Victorian evidence regimes.

This new edition builds on the work of Peter Bayne, the author of the 1st edition. It continues his style of integrated discussion of the uniform Evidence Acts with evidentiary principles to achieve a seamless analysis of the law. The significant legislative amendments to the uniform Evidence Acts resulting from the Australian Law Reform Commission's Uniform Evidence Law Report of December 2005 are incorporated to ensure the most up-to-date coverage of the law in the uniform Evidence Act jurisdictions. The case extracts have been updated to reflect the most current judicial interpretations of the uniform Evidence Acts and judicial statements of evidentiary principles. The chapter order now more closely reflects the structure of the uniform Evidence Acts and the incremental topic sequencing of most university undergraduate courses in evidence law. Also, Victora has recently joined the uniform Evidence Act scheme with their new Evidence Act due to commence operation later in 2009 or early 2010. Uniform Evidence Law is an essential tool and will enhance the understanding of the practical operation of evidence law in the various litigation contexts in which it arises.
